Etymology of the English word glyptics

the English word glyptics
derived from the English word glyptic
derived from the French word glyptique
derived from the Late Greek word gluptikos, γλυπτικός
derived from the Greek word gluptos, γλυπτός
derived from the Greek word gluphein, γλύφειν, γλύϕω (to carve)
derived from the Proto-Indo-European root *gleubh-
derived from the Greek word gluptes
derived from the Greek word gluphein, γλύφειν, γλύϕω (to carve)
derived from the Proto-Indo-European root *gleubh-
using the English suffix -ics
